We're hiring a school Lead Cleaner!

We're looking for a friendly and reliable lead cleaner to join our team at Lift Firth Park. As a lead cleaner you will be responsible for ensuring all cleaning tasks in the school are complete daily, during times when the cleaning supervisor is not available. The hours for this role are: 2:15pm - 6:15pm per day (Monday to Friday)

You're someone who'll be able to:
  • You should be highly motivated, enthusiastic and hardworking.
  • Although you will at times work under the direction of the cleaning supervisor, you should be able to work both in a team and independently, and be able to lead the team in absence of the cleaning supervisor.
  • Experienced in cleaning large premises and familiarity with COSHH requirements is desirable, although training will be given.
About our school.

Lift Firth Park is a vibrant, mixed secondary school for students aged 11-16. Located in Shiregreen, Sheffield, we serve around 1,200 pupils and reflect a richly diverse community, with more than a third of students speaking English as an additional language.

The school is currently undergoing an exciting period of transformational change, and we are already seeing its positive impact-in the classroom, across the curriculum and throughout our culture.
